Actually sometime ago there was an article that appeared on one of the
magazines (not Pop Comm, not Monitoring Times, the other one that I
can't remember the name of). The article described a mod which would
remove filtering and allow 800-900 MHz signals to be heard as images in
the 400 MHz range on the scanner.... I believe that was what he was
refering too.

However you'll hear a lot of buzzing sound as in many areas the amount
of analog traffic is being reduced. Here in Central FL you'll still
hear some analog but only about 1 out of 15 signals will be analog. And
I'm actually surpised its still that high but it is....
